What to know about NOLA rental arbitrage financing
Financing a short-term rental arbitrage business in New Orleans requires a different strategy than traditional real estate investing. Because you are not buying the property, you cannot use traditional mortgages. Instead, you need startup capital for short term rentals that treats your business as an operating entity. This often confuses new hosts who try to apply for real estate loans rather than business credit products.
The financing options available to you fall into three distinct buckets, each with different qualifying triggers. Understanding these is the difference between getting a quick denial and receiving the capital needed to launch.
1. Unsecured Business Lines of Credit
These are the gold standard for arbitrage. Unlike a term loan, a line of credit allows you to draw funds for furniture, deposits, and cleaning fees as you add units. Once you pay it down, the capital is available again. In 2026, most lenders will look for a FICO score above 700 to offer the most competitive terms, with APRs generally falling in the 9–13% range. 2. Equipment Financing
If your primary hurdle is the upfront cost of furnishing properties to high standards, you do not necessarily need a general business loan. Equipment financing allows you to borrow specifically against the assets you are buying (beds, appliances, smart-home tech). These loans are often easier to secure because the equipment itself acts as collateral. Many lenders approve these within 24 to 48 hours.
3. Personal vs. Business Credit
Many entrepreneurs begin by using personal credit cards, but this is a temporary fix. You will hit a "credit wall" where your personal debt-to-income ratio prevents further growth. The goal is to establish business credit early. Lenders view arbitrage in highly regulated cities as riskier, meaning your business plan needs to clearly articulate how you handle permits and compliance.
| Financing Type | Best For | Typical Speed | Primary Requirement |
|---|---|---|---|
| Unsecured Line of Credit | Operational cash flow | 1–3 weeks | 700+ FICO |
| Equipment Financing | Furniture & tech | 24–48 hours | Self-collateralizing assets |
| Term Loans | Large-scale expansion | 30–45 days | 24 months in business |
When applying for unsecured business loans for rental arbitrage, expect lenders to review at least 3–6 months of bank statements to verify consistent revenue. If your business is brand new, they will default to your personal credit score. Do not make the mistake of applying for multiple loans simultaneously; each hard inquiry will lower your score by 3–5 points, potentially disqualifying you from the "good credit" tiers needed for the best rates. Finally, ensure your business entity (LLC) is properly registered with the Louisiana Secretary of State before applying, as lenders will verify your business status before moving past the pre-qualification stage.
